High Income Securities Fund (PCF) To Go Ex-Dividend on June 16th

High Income Securities Fund (NYSE:PCFGet Free Report) announced a monthly dividend on Monday, April 13th. Stockholders of record on Tuesday, June 16th will be given a dividend of 0.058 per share by the financial services provider on Tuesday, June 30th. This represents a c) d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 12.5%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Tuesday, June 16th.

High Income Securities Fund Stock Performance

PCF opened at $5.59 on Friday. The company’s 50-day simple moving average is $5.63 and its two-hundred day simple moving average is $5.87. High Income Securities Fund has a 52-week low of $5.36 and a 52-week high of $6.51.

High Income Securities Fund (NYSE: PCF) is a closed-end management investment company dedicated to delivering a high level of total return, with an emphasis on current income. The fund invests primarily in a diversified portfolio of below-investment-grade debt securities, including corporate high-yield bonds, bank loans and other fixed-income instruments. While the majority of its holdings are denominated in U.S. dollars, the fund may also invest in non-U.S. issuers and currency exposures as part of its global credit strategy.

To pursue its objectives, PCF may employ leverage in the form of borrowings and preferred stock issuance, enhancing its capacity to generate income but also introducing additional risk.
